Acqua di Parma Blu Mediterraneo limited editions

Posted by Robin on 1 May 2014 4 Comments

Acqua di Parma Blu Mediterraneo limited editions, 1 of 2

From Acqua di Parma's Blu Mediterraneo brand, limited editions of all six fragrances with decorated caps:

Acqua di Parma invites you to journey to Sardinia and discover the latest addition to the Blu Mediterraneo collection. In partnership with the Selfridges Beauty Project, Acqua di Parma will be hosting an Italian Design Artist at Selfridges London, from 24 April to 7 May, creating unique, Mediterranean inspired, fragrance bottle caps. The bottle caps will be created in limited quantities with the purchase of any 150ml fragrance from the Blu Mediterraneo range and available in store for a limited amount of time only.

Shown above is the newest, Ginepro di Sardegna, with Arancia di Capri and Mandorlo di Sicilia. Below, Mirto di Panarea, Fico di Amalfi and Bergamotto di Calabria.

Acqua di Parma Blu Mediterraneo limited editions, 2 of 2

The Blu Mediterraneo limited editions are available now at Selfridges in the UK, £78 for 150 ml Eau de Toilette (the same price as the regular bottle in that size).
